House committee warns Senate changes to 'T bill' could shift paving priorities and add mileage-based fee

House Transportation Committee · April 2, 2026
AI-Generated Content: All content on this page was generated by AI to highlight key points from the meeting. For complete details and context, we recommend watching the full video. so we can fix them.

Summary

House Transportation members said the Senate is drafting a substantially different version of the transportation (T) bill, including proposals to spread paving funds more broadly and consider a mileage-based user fee; the House said it will defend its version that prioritizes interstate paving to maximize federal matches.

House Transportation committee members told colleagues on April 2 that the Senate Transportation Committee is working on a substantially different version of the broader T bill, and that the House will press to defend its priorities.
